Richard W. Hong, MD, FASA

Dr. Hong is a Clinical Professor of Anesthesiology at UCLA, which involves overseeing obstetric anesthesiology practices at Ronald Reagan Medical Center, Santa Monica-UCLA Orthopaedic Hospital, and Martin Luther King, Jr. Community Hospital working along side other subspecialists in his division. He pursued fellowship training in obstetric anesthesiology before beginning his career at UCLA in 2007.
